Transaction 70e81a30277c23cded9514fe0651a8fbd8598783a74616a8d78a3b19e30c6906
1 Input
1 Output
-
70e81a30277c23cded9514fe0651a8fbd8598783a74616a8d78a3b19e30c6906:0
- value
- 38206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eff6b142b0610e73133fd30d3b75396652a57b98 OP_EQUAL
- address
- 3PZpwt52spZwvWWoMACd5ZSDEA3TDoPmzz